#fb454c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fb454c is composed of 98.4% red, 27.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 357.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 62.7%. #fb454c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a98 with #f70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#fb454c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fb454c has RGB values of R:251, G:69,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.7,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16467276.

Shades and Tints of #fb454c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060000 is the darkest color, while #fff2f2 is the lightest one.
